Introduce your business and what you do there.
Our product is called TravBook, which is a travel-oriented social network platform. We aim at creating an inclusive community connecting travelers of similar interests and seek to provide the most authentic, barrier-free traveling experiences to all travelers around the world. Our business is based in Singapore targeting SEA [South East Asia] markets. I am the founder and chief executive officer and am in charge of executives and operations.
What challenge were you trying to address with Fooyo?
The main challenge was the development of mobile applications, as it is hard for a new startup to process such a heavy workload team at the start. Fooyo was able to offer us the best of the solutions at the best prices. They successfully helped us to create a beautiful app supported on both iOS and Android platforms.
What was the scope of their involvement?
They came in and helped us all the way, from initial idea building to UI/UX [user interface/user experience] design, with insightful suggestions at every step of our app development. They came out with the best function design based on our requirements, such as the logic behind our verification and level systems.
How did you come to work with Fooyo?
A common friend introduced them to us while we were looking for suitable companies. There were five to six companies on the list. From what we evaluated, they were able to offer the best products within a short period of time at a really reasonable price.
How much have you invested with Fooyo?
There were two stages of developments on our app; the total price range is from 100,000 to 150,000 SGD [~70,000 to 100,000 USD].
What is the status of this engagement?
We started working roughly from May 2016, and both stages of developments have just ended this early December.
Could you share any evidence that would demonstrate the productivity, quality of work, or the impact of the engagement?
Fooyo managed to engage with us once every two weeks to update on all details of development, so as to keep track of our new requirements. They are also very generous towards new requirements without demanding extra payments. We kept in touch on every detail during the process, and they have proved to be extremely responsive whenever any issue is raised. The quality of work is perfect, way above our expectations.
How did Fooyo perform in terms of project management?
They performed very well this entire project in terms of responsiveness, quality, and professionalism at work.
What did you find most impressive about Fooyo?
I would say efficiency. It’s amazing how they are able to accomplish such a great project within such a short period of time, with high-quality results delivered.
Are there any areas where Fooyo could improve?
I believe they have done a great job providing us the solutions.
What tips or recommendations could you share that might increase the likelihood of success with Fooyo?
I might focus on the promptness of communications between clients and Fooyo. This plays an extremely important part when it comes down to how well the product turns out to be what the clients expected.

Introduce your business and what you do there.
My partner and I started a social food discovery startup in Jakarta, Indonesia.
What challenge were you trying to address with Fooyo?
We needed help with developing a mobile app based on an idea we had. Because Jakarta lacked skilled developers, we decided to invest in Fooyo.
What was the scope of their involvement?
We asked Fooyo to develop our mobile apps for iOS and Android as well as the backend with Ruby on Rails. With the help of a third-party UI/UX firm, Fooyo developed our apps from the ground up. This consisted of an MVP [minimum viable product] and a fully functioning iOS, Android, and Ruby on Rails app.
How did you come to work with Fooyo?
We met with several development houses in Jakarta and Singapore. Based on their body of work, skill, chemistry, and pricing, we decided to go with Fooyo.
How much have you invested with Fooyo?
We have invested more than 50,000 SGD (~35,000 USD) with Fooyo.
What is the status of this engagement?
We contracted them from October 2015 to January 2016. Soon after the project completion, they worked with us once more for small functionality changes in the apps. We still speak on a regular basis but we no longer contract them for more work. We have our own developers now.
Could you share any evidence that would demonstrate the productivity, quality of work, or the impact of the engagement?
Fooyo is a small team and the scope of our project was quite large considering we required 3 apps. Working remotely, they delivered the project within 2.5 months. That is very impressive.
How did Fooyo perform in terms of project management?
They practice Agile and they did a very good job managing our project. We worked directly with all members of their team, including the project manager and developers.
What did you find most impressive about Fooyo?
We appreciated that they took ownership of the project. It never felt that they were taking shortcuts. They had their own input on how the app should be like. We were impressed by Fooyo's work ethic and attitude, which included late nights on our project.
